“Lynch RSS, BJP people on streets”, man incites in TN public transport

The video of a man asking people to come out on the streets and lynch BJP and RSS people has gone viral on social media. Much similar to evangelical preaching, he called for violence against BJP, RSS people on a public transport vehicle in Tamil Nadu, and said that the public should do something like the recent protests in Srilanka.

“You can solve this only by thrashing them on the street..not by voting in assembly and parliament elections. People should come out on the streets. Thrash BJP, RSS people like they did in Srilanka”.

One of the passengers got up and retorted “I’m an RSS person. Will you thrash me? Why would you thrash me? Did I do something to your family? What reason do you have to beat me and ask others to do the same?”.
